Abstract
Connecting smart, low energy peripherals using Bluetooth Low Energy seems easy enough; the devices and API’s are available since Android 4.3, but only until you start using those API’s you’ll encounter strange, undocumented and sometimes surprising details. In this session I’ll talk about Android BLE and the particularities of it, by taking the experience and learnings of building the unofficial SDK for the LightBlue Bean. This session will cover what BLE is, the key API’s involved and will highlight tips, tricks and issues for each API.
